Inverter Technology Keeps Things Smooth and Quiet
One of the biggest contributors to HVAC noise is the constant cycling on and off.
Traditional systems run at full power, shut down, and then restart repeatedly throughout the day.
Each cycle creates noise spikes that can be disruptive.
Panasonic heat pumps use advanced inverter technology to avoid this issue.
Rather than turning on and off, the system adjusts its speed continuously based on your home’s needs.
This steady operation eliminates those abrupt starts and stops, resulting in a much quieter experience overall.
